About

Dr. Brooks graduated from GEORGETOWN UNIVERSITY / MEDICAL CENTER. Dr. Cortni Brooks, MD is a Gastroenterologist in Harrisburg, PA and has 17 years experience. Dr. Brooks currently practices at Practice and is affiliated with UPMC Harrisburg. Dr. Brooks has experience treating conditions like Constipation, Diarrhea, Nausea, Gastritis, Irritable Bowel Syndrome, Lactose Intolerance, Diffuse Esophageal Spasm, Acute Gastritis,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ease (GERD), Gastrointestinal Bleeding, Dysphagia, Abdominal Pain and Duodenitis among other conditions at varying frequencies. Dr. Brooks's office accepts new patients and telehealth appointments. Dr. Brooks is board certified in Gastroenterology and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
